What term describes the extinction of two interdependent species?​

1 Answer

6 votes

Answer:

Co-extinction

Step-by-step explanation:

Co-extinction- occurs as a result of extinction of interdependent species. When one interdependent species is lost its also leads to the extinction of the other species. Example is Two lice that lives on a bird. extinction of an interdependent species a lice will lead to extinction of the other lice.
